Temples consecrated by Narayana Guru

1

Narayana Guru built temples at various locations in India: Kollam, Thiruvananthapuram, Thrissur, Kannur, Anchuthengu, Thalassery, Kozhikode, Mangalore. Some of the temples built by the guru are: Shiva temple established at Aruvippuram, Thiruvananthapuram Devi Temple dedicated at Mannanthala, Thiruvananthapuram Temple established at AayiramThengu, Alappad, Kollam Temple established at Poothotta, Ernakulam Sri Narayana krishnan Kovil, Pilackool, Thalassery, Kannur Dedicated Sree Subrahmanya Temple (Sree Dharmashastha Temple), Earathu near Kayikkara Thiruvananthapuram Bhagavathi temple dedicated at Karunagappalli (near Kunnazathu), Kollam Subrhamaniya temple dedicated at Vazhamuttam, Kunnumpara, Thiruvananthapuram Sree Narayanapuram krishna Temple, Aashraamam, Kollam The Sree Bhakthi Samvardhini Yogam, Kannur was constituted with the blessings of Sree Narayana Guru Jaganatha Shiva Temple at Thalasserry, Kannur dedicated.
